Did you know?

Of teams they’ve faced at least 10 times in the Premier League, against no side have Southampton won a higher share of their matches in the competition than they have against Crystal Palace (58 per cent, with 14 wins out of 24).

Southampton haven’t won any of their last 24 Premier League away contests played on Wednesdays (D8 L16), with their last such victory coming at Chelsea in April 1995 (2-0).

Crystal Palace striker Christian Benteke has scored six goals in his last nine Premier League outings against Southampton. Only against Chelsea and Sunderland (seven each) has he scored more in the competition.

Palace have only lost one of their eight Premier League home matches this season (W3 D4). Only Liverpool have lost fewer on home soil in the competition this term (none). Palace are now looking to win back-to-back league encounters at Selhurst Park for the first time since March 2020.
